Former Commander of U.S. Central Command General Michael “Erik” Kurilla Joins Lazard as Senior Advisor
Businesswire· 2025-10-03 11:21
NEW YORK--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Lazard, Inc. (NYSE: LAZ), the preeminent global financial advisory and asset management firm, announced today that Retired Four-Star U.S. Army General and Former Commander of U.S. Central Command Michael "Erik†Kurilla has joined as Senior Advisor in Lazard's Geopolitical Advisory group, effective immediately. General Kurilla brings deep expertise in strategic command within complex environments, most notably in the Middle East and Central Asia. His appointment builds. ...
